Passengers describe 'terrifying' evacuation from undersea tunnel

Passengers traveling from France to England were evacuated from a Eurotunnel train underneath the English Channel on Tuesday before being left stranded for hours.

“A train has broken down in the tunnel and we are in the process of transferring customers to a separate passenger shuttle via the service tunnel, to return to our Folkestone terminal,” Eurotunnel tweeted late Tuesday UK time. “We apologise sincerely for this inconvenience.”

Eurotunnel Le Shuttle runs trains that carry passenger and freight vehicles through a tunnel between England and France.

The breakdown affected the 3.50 p.m. local time service from Calais, France, to Folkestone, England, which was carrying hundreds of people as well as several dogs, the PA Media news agency reported
